Man Utd’s Mourinho praises Southampton - ‘I was afraid…’

Published on: 27 February 2017

Manchester United boss Jose Mourinho has given high praise to Southampton in the wake of Sunday's EFL Cup final.

The Saints fought back courageously at Wembley to make it 2-2 through a Manolo Gabbiadini brace after United had lead by two goals late in the first half.

A late Zlatan Ibrahimovic header denied Claude Puel's side the chance to recreate history after their 1976 FA Cup triumph over United but it certainly was a difficult affair for Mourinho and his men which the Portuguese admits he was scared of.

"This game was a tricky final, Southampton are a club that is growing," he said.

"They have good players, a good coach, their fans were the same number as our fans, so this was a tricky kind of final.

"I was afraid of this one more than the other finals when you know another giant is the other side. This one was tricky."
